LPL Financial's Pioneering Vision

The History of
LPL Financial

Formed in 1989 through the merger of two brokerage firms, Linsco and Private Ledger, LPL was designed as an alternative to traditional Wall Street firms. The founders’ revolutionary vision was centered around helping financial professionals build competitive businesses while they served their clients’ best interests—treating them like people, not accounts. That remains true of LPL today.

FOUNDATIONAL VALUES THAT INFORM OUR VISION

At a time when few paid attention to the concept of financial planning, Private Ledger founder Bob Ritzman sought to offer a large group of mutual funds and securities to advisors—without pushing a particular product. And when Todd Robinson purchased Linsco in 1985, he was anticipating the growing desire for advisors to run their own independent practices—which proved true during the aftermath of the stock market crash in October 1987.
 

It was in the midst of this rapidly changing industry environment that LPL was formed. The entrepreneurial vision of Linsco and Private Ledger fused to form a guiding principle—supporting the best interests of its advisors and their clients.
 

More than 30 years later, LPL has become a Fortune 500 company and launched a new brand, yet this guiding principle remains—it’s simply expanded far beyond the investment services offered. Alongside the constant pace of change in the financial services industry and the world around us, LPL has evolved its technology, operations, risk management, and business consulting—while continuing to innovate its investment management services and platforms.

Financial professional ethics and codes
 

Trust in a financial professional is essential for a good working relationship, and trust is built on knowing that a financial professional adheres to legal and ethical standards. LPL financial professionals abide by LPL's Code of Conduct [PDF] and Code of Ethics [PDF], which requires them to comply with all applicable federal securities laws. Depending on the certifications and professional designations they hold, they must also adhere to various industry standards. For example, any financial professional with the Certified Financial Planner (CFP) designation is subject to standards set by the CFP board. This includes the CFP Code of Ethics and Standards of Conduct.
 

LPL financial professionals have a passion for doing their work ethically, in line with LPL’s core values. For you that means the integrity and professionalism you expect is what you will get when you work with an LPL financial professional.

LPL financial professionals focus on doing what’s right for you. They’ll help you understand the differences between advisory and brokerage services, how your relationship with them will work, the services they’ll provide, any associated fees, and disclose potential conflicts of interest.
